50,000 hryvnias for children of defenders: in Lviv, the center on Pekarska accepts applications for assistance

Applications for assistance of 50,000 hryvnias for children of fallen defenders of Ukraine and children of military personnel with 1st group disability (acquired as a result of the war) are accepted by the Lviv Center for the provision of services to combatants at Pekarska Street, 41. Currently, 146 such applications have been submitted, according to which payments will be made 184 children will already receive it.

In particular, we are talking about annual one-time assistance for each child in the amount of 50,000 hryvnias for education and rehabilitation (until reaching the age of majority). To receive assistance, one of the parents or a legal representative (guardian) submits an application to the Lviv Center for the provision of services to combatants, operating at 41 Pekarska Street.

A sample application is in the position, which is also attached below.

“The Department of Social Protection and the Center for the provision of services to participants in hostilities have developed a provision according to which the effect of this program extends to the children of fallen defenders of Ukraine, as well as children of soldiers with disabilities of the 1st group. The aid is determined in the amount of 50 thousand hryvnias, it is annual and is given to children from birth to 18 years of age. As of today, 146 applications for such assistance have already been submitted, and these are 184 children. But, of course, we have funds provided for a larger amount – that is, everyone who is subject to this program will receive this payment,” says Oleksiy Nedilya, v. at. Head of the Department of Social Protection of the Lviv City Council.

At the same time, if for certain objective reasons the family of the defender cannot receive documents certifying the status of the family of the deceased this year, then this assistance will be received next year – both for this year and for the previous year (2023 and 2024).

Support of war participants and their families is one of the priorities in Lviv. From 2016 to 2022, financial assistance in the amount of 10,000 hryvnias was paid to the children of ATO/OOS participants who died (missing) or died, and Heroes of the Heavenly Hundred. During this time, 912 children (under the age of 18 or under 23 – if they study full-time at a higher education institution) received assistance.

Also, from 2015 to 2022, the children of the participants of the ATO/OOS, injured participants of the Revolution of Dignity and Heroes of the Heavenly Hundred, were provided with one-time financial aid for recovery. During this time, 3,178 child defenders received such payments (up to 18 years of age in the amount of 3, 4, 6 and 7 thousand hryvnias for each child, depending on the categories). Applications for these programs were accepted by the Lviv Center for the Provision of Services to Combatants, located at 41 Pekarska Street.

It should be noted that before the start of the full-scale invasion, about 7,000 war participants (ATO/OOS) lived in Lviv, now the number of our soldiers is many times greater. The Lviv City Council is doing everything to help them as much as possible. These are material support, benefits, treatment, prosthetics and rehabilitation, psychological and legal consultations, adaptation to civilian life – through excursions, art and other activities, support for veteran businesses and various social assistance programs.
